Gladys Knight announces four UK dates (2016)

Story by Jack Foley
GLADYS Knight, the seven-time Grammy Award winning icon, has announced four UK dates in July, 2016, including London’s Royal Albert Hall on July 1.
Knight will be performing all her classic hits, from Midnight Train To Georgia (which remains one of the most famous Motown records to date and was honoured as one of ‘The Greatest Songs Of All Time’ by Rolling Stone Magazine) through to Licence To Kill (the official theme song to the James Bond film), plus tracks from her latest album ‘Where My Heart Belongs’.
Tickets go on sale Friday, March 4 at 9am.
The dates are (all July 2016)
2 – London Royal Albert Hall
3 – Nottingham Royal Centre
5 – Leeds First Direct Arena
6 – Edinburgh Festival Theatre
Tickets for the London date cost £75 (for boxes) and range from £67.50 to £42.50.
